I have created a page using the built-in List template in Google Sites. However, the list appears after all the other text. How can I move the list to the top of the page?

The only way I've found to do this is as follows:
- Copy the contents of the list onto your computer's clipboard. You need to do this first, as the list isn't stored in the revision history, and will be permanently deleted!
- Change the template used for the page to Web Page.
- Edit the page (press the 'e' key to edit it)
- Paste the list from your computer's clipboard into the page, where you want it to be.
- Go to the row containing the words "sort", and from the Table menu in Google Sites, select Delete Row.
- Save the page.
It now won't be a "proper List" as before unfortunately, so you won't be able to add items directly from the page - you'll have to go in and edit the page in order to add items to the list.
